| You should take a look at the Beacon Hill area in Kowloon. It's fairly close to the Kowloon Tong MTR station by small bus. There are a couple of 3br/2bath flats at around 1000 square feet for approximately $28000 a month. It's a lot like living back in the Toronto suburbs -- quiet, and the air is quite fresh there too. |
